Golden Heaven Group Holdings Ltd is an offshore holding company. Through the operating entities in China, it manages and operates six properties consisting of amusement parks, water parks, and complementary recreational facilities. The parks offer a broad selection of exhilarating and recreational experiences, including both thrilling and family-friendly rides, water attractions, gourmet festivals, circus performances, and high-tech facilities. The firm's revenue is generated from selling access to rides and attractions, charging fees for special event rentals, and collecting regular rental payments from commercial tenants. it opearts in the Cayman Islands, PRC, BVI, and HK.
Texas Community Bancshares Inc is a holding company. The company's business consists of taking deposits from the general public and investing those deposits, together with funds generated from operations and borrowings from the Federal Home Loan Bank of Dallas, in residential real estate loans and commercial real estate loans and, to a lesser extent, commercial loans, construction and land loans, and consumer and other loans. Its portfolio segments are real estate, agriculture, commercial, consumer and other.
